Hunters have used deer blinds over the last century to great success. Learning how to choose the perfect deer blind for your needs can be an important first step in taking your hunting skills to the next level. Having the ability to watch your prey without being seen give you a far better understanding of your target. It also allows you to take a cleaner shot without worrying about alerting your prey and missing your opportunity.
Recently advances in camouflage have increased the effectiveness of these hunting tools and as a result of this, many new hunters are rushing to the market to purchase one of these tried and true hunting blinds. The problem is not every hunting blind is created equal and the majority of blind manufacturers lack he experience to deliver a high-quality product that is both effective and reliable. 2. Primos Double Bull Deluxe Ground Blind

The Primos Double Bull Deluxe Ground Blind utilizes a zipperless doublewide silent entry and exit door to keep your movements as stealthy as possible. You don’t want to alert your prey by using zippers or velcro, so this feature is a huge selling point this unit has over the majority of the competition. This is a large entry that also gives you a 180-degree full front view of your hunting ground. The windows also utilize the patented Silent Slide Design so you can get a full awareness of any approaching prey before they have any idea you are there.
Primos is known for their use of quality materials and their excellent construction methods. This unit is manufactured from Double Bull materials and can withstand heavy use before showing any signs of wear. You can tell a lot of research went into this design and the added height makes this blind ideal for taller hunters. This hunting tent is 77″ tall with a shooting space of 60″ x 60″. This gives you enough room to fit all of your gear away and stay silent while you watch your prey from the shadows. This blind does not have a floor so you may want to clear any dead leaves from the area you are setting up at.

3. Ameristep Care Taker Hub Blind-Realtree Xtra

The Ameristep Care Taker Hub Blind-Realtree Xtra features Shadow Guard Technology to give you an added edge when stalking your prey. Experienced hunters will tell you, deer are very intuitive to their surroundings and the sight of a shadow moving from inside your blind can be enough to spoke them it running off. The creative minds at Ameristep tackled this issue head on and came up with this patented Shadow Guard Design. This unit also includes a Shoot-Through Mesh Design that allows you to remain completely hidden, even when taking your shot. Another advantage you get with this deer blind is added protection from insects. The mesh on this tent is designed to be Insect Resistant as well as camo.
The Durashell Plus Materials give you increased protection from harsh weather conditions and the shooting width has been increased from previous versions. You now get 69″ of shooting space, this can give you the added floor space you need for more gear, or even adding another hunter. This tent has windows that can be opened to allow for a full 360-degree view of your hunting ground. Set up is easy and the entire process can be done in around ten minutes. This unit is a little heavier than the majority of competitor’s brands but the added weight is due to the use of more durable materials.

How do you get inside the double bull ground blind if it doesn’t use zippers or velcros? And how does it stay closed?
The Primos Double Bull Deluxe Ground Blind uses a combination of toggles and buckles. Its very simple, to enter you just undo the toggles and then the buckle. Its the exact opposite for closing it.
